Attackers have drained roughly $88.6 million in Bitcoin from Coldcard hardware wallets and are still going, with researchers at Galaxy warning that every vulnerable address will eventually be emptied.
Galaxy Research said on Saturday it had identified a third wave of thefts in which 207.73 BTC was swept, lifting its observed total to about 1,367 BTC across 4,585 addresses. The firm called the exploit ongoing.
